Submitting Your Application
Applying for a trades job shouldn’t feel like another full-time job. Our online application is simple and easy to complete. We respect your time and ask for the information needed to understand your background and determine whether the opportunity may be a strong match.
Once your application is submitted, our recruiting team reviews it carefully. We are not just looking at job titles. We are looking at the skills, experience, and character you could bring to the team.

Meeting The Team

During the interview process, you may meet with a service manager, team leader, or others connected to the position. Expect a genuine conversation about your skills, work experience, safety mindset, and how you approach customers and teammates.
Depending on the role, you may also visit an office, shop, or work environment. This gives you the chance to see where you could work, meet future teammates, and get a feel for the culture.

Starting Your First Day
Day one is about helping you feel welcomed and prepared. You will meet your team, receive the tools, gear, technology, or resources needed for your role, and begin learning how we work together.
Our orientation introduces you to our culture, safety expectations, benefits, and day-to-day processes. You won’t be expected to know everything immediately. Training, mentorship, and support continue well beyond your first day.
